Based on 268 recent sales, the median property price is £410,000 (about £366 per square foot) in Ecclesall area, with individual transactions ranging from £56,689 up to £1,360,000.
| Type | Sales | Median | £/sq ft |
|---|---|---|---|
| Detached | 37 | £625,000 | £428 |
| Semi-Detached | 130 | £426,500 | £390 |
| Terraced | 48 | £358,350 | £313 |
| Flats | 53 | £175,100 | £273 |

Postcode S11 9RH is located in a minor urban area, within the Ecclesall ward of Sheffield in the Yorkshire and The Humber region, and forms part of the Bents Green & Millhouses area. It has very low deprivation and very low crime levels, with around 29.9 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 73% below the Yorkshire and The Humber average of 113 per 1,000. The average income per household in Bents Green & Millhouses is £76,432 per year. The nearest station is Dore and Totley, about 1.8 miles away. There are 6 primary and 2 secondary schools in the area.
